

Inmates can release cell property at any time while in MCSO custody by submitting an Inmate Request Form.

If their items are not picked up in 30 days of the inmate's release to DOC, then the property is sent for destruction. Prior to the inmates transfer to DOC (Department of Corrections) inmates are encouraged to fill out a DOC RELEASE FORM which allows all booked-in personal property items to be released to anyone that comes in and asks for it, or they may list a specific person for it to be released to. Picture ID’s made at swap meets, or store ID cards like Sam’s Club are not valid ID’s. An Immigration card (work visa card, or resident alien card) presented with a DMV card is acceptable.

The location of the property to be picked-up is provided by the inmate.The person picking up the property will need to provide a government issued picture identification card (ID), such as a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) identification card/driver’s license that is current and valid.

The inmate can release their property to anyone they choose including their attorney, public defender, probation officer or caseworker. Inmates must release all booked-in personal property, except for their clothing, when requesting a property release. For the General Public Revised - Information is subject to change 1.
